Transaction edec63fd5d7a9061f4ee2ee41edcafb1a725c01bf36c53667599300de09718d6
1 Input
1 Output
-
edec63fd5d7a9061f4ee2ee41edcafb1a725c01bf36c53667599300de09718d6:0
- value
- 131234
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cba74794ff78566b5945c894075c0b54c24e7726675ad09299ca72b6caab2e56
- address
- bc1pewn5098l0ptxkk29ez2qwhqt2npyuaexvaddpy5eefetdj4t9etqcgakr4